About Alabama’s Fox Squirrels Fox squirrels have a large diet, which includes acorns , nuts, seeds, fleshy fruits, buds, flowers, twigs, bird eggs, insects, tubers, roots, and fungi. The fox squirrel, not as agile a climber, tends to gravitate to more open areas and places with a mix of hardwood and pine trees. Home. The fox squirrel, which is slightly larger than the gray squirrel, varies in color, but often is rusty yellow with gray down its back and neck. According to the wildlife regulations in Alabama, homeowners are allowed to remove one nuisance gray squirrel out of season without a permit (Alabama Department of Conservation and Natural Resources Administrative Code, Chapter 220-2-27).
